Output 03c23dbb653d4420e481c9717451a0532513f8c1007c01eba9ac76751c9c6659:0

value
76356601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 744b8e730ef9f321485cd5baaf83d8b7e36ad510 OP_EQUAL
address
3CHvpYqjjBUfjWLpuEns2cGChqbqphwJMs
transaction
03c23dbb653d4420e481c9717451a0532513f8c1007c01eba9ac76751c9c6659
spent
true